Key Points:

  • Commodity chemical markets reflect an abnormal level of volatility YTD. This report comments on relevant chemical market trends and US wholesale inventory-to-sale ratios that provide proof of far-from-normal conditions.
  • We flag pertinent chemical sector corporate items (e.g., DuPont, Ganfeng Lithium & McDermott strategic moves, Multiple global production updates, price hike announcements, & chemical sector capital deployment items)  
  • This report’s other relevant items include a discussion of the development of a CO2-free hydrogen value chain, an increased focus on carbon capture & sequestration (CCS) opportunities, and the deployment of capital to increase the production capacity of several global base chemical products.
